Florida BON just approves the curriculum as stated when it is delivered to them. They cannot do site visits to actually see what is happening. It used to be that a for-profit school had to have a 10% below national  average (usually 82-85%) for 3 years running.. Schools started instituting an 'exit exam' to bar low performing students from graduating.

The State instituted a new criteria. Schools had to obtain accreditation for CCNE or ACEN within 5 years or less for long time existing schools. But unfortunately even after a school knew they were going to lose approval they continued to admit students, collect tuition and fees.
